Keris Panjang Lurus Riau Lingga 709.

Keris Panjang Lurus Riau Lingga 709 – A rare example of a long keris from the Sumatran region of Riau Lingga. Handle in the tapak kuda or horse hoof’s form is made of hard dark woods, with the top sheath in the sabit bulan or crescent moon form. The bottom stem or gandar is encase with a plain silver at the top and silver rings along the base with a horn bottom tip in the patat lipas or roaches back form.

Very long and slim, but very sturdy straight blade with well executed base features of perabots typical of the keris panjang.
Use for execution by thrusting the blade into the left shoulder downwards towards the heart. It is said to be bloodless.

Pamor patterns are arranged in the mlumah technique of the wos utah or scattered rice variations.
The pamor wos utah is said to enhance the owner’s material well being, and the keris panjang is reserved for high status wear.

Age:  Krises are traditionally made without any date stampings or engravings of the makers' name. Although a kris smith or "empu" has his own styles configured together with the dapor and especially the ganjar (cross piece). Obvious age wear and tear, usage, familiarity with forms, motifs and designs, origin and history, mediums and materials used are our guidelines in determining an approximate age. This particular piece, from our experience and knowledge, should go back to late 19th century.
